Sweet Potato, Kale & Tempeh Salad with Cashew Dressing

A hearty and nutritious salad featuring roasted sweet potatoes, kale, and tempeh, topped with a creamy cashew dressing. Perfect for a filling vegan meal packed with flavor and health benefits.

Ingredients

1 pound sweet potatoes (about 2 medium), scrubbed and cut into 1-inch cubes; 1 ½ teaspoons extra-virgin olive oil; ¼ teaspoon kosher salt; ⅛ teaspoon ground pepper; 1/2 cup Cashew Dressing (see Associated Recipes); 6 cups chopped curly kale; 2 cups marinated tempeh, grilled or baked; ¼ cup chopped unsalted cashews.

Instructions

1.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C). Toss the sweet potatoes with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Spread on a baking sheet and roast for 20-25 minutes, until tender and lightly browned. 2. Massage the chopped kale with a little olive oil and salt until it softens. 3. In a large bowl, combine the roasted sweet potatoes, massaged kale, grilled tempeh, and chopped cashews. 4. Drizzle with Cashew Dressing and toss to combine. Serve immediately or refrigerate for later.

Allergens

Tree Nuts (Cashews), Soy (Tempeh)
